Bout a laptop Lenovo T540p many years ago. Used a few times. Put in store room since 2021. There was a login password in the years before 2016. The login password was deleted in 2016. I take the laptop out of the store room and try to start it, but Windows asks for login password.

How to solve this problem, please?

Reset password requires old password.

No.

you enter a new password. irrespective of what it thought the old one was

12) When the PC restarts a Command window will open, in that window type "net user <username> <new password>" mine is (net user "Bare Foot Kid" Test6) be advised: if you have a username like mine, with spaces, you must use " " quotes around the user name; when you get the "Command Completed Successfully" type "exit" in the Command window and hit enter; at the logon screen use the new password you chose.
